Output 56c7ad76a11d863d71359d1224c044d2c2c9d67ec8563e3f307a0fb26f90ab2b:2

value
144020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6b752b5bda4adc0d73a57fcf52ccb4665c91ed5 OP_EQUAL
address
3QBXmFBYiWU3FMB2ScPXCFTYhgBCbjZnjS
transaction
56c7ad76a11d863d71359d1224c044d2c2c9d67ec8563e3f307a0fb26f90ab2b
confirmations
300464
spent
true